How to Conduct a Meeting Effectively

Did you know that organizing and running your meetings is one of the most significant “risk factors” for participation and member investment in the organization? All aspects of a meeting are essential: planning, logistics, and chairing abilities and ideals. All of these elements have an impact on member participation and involvement.

Furthermore, each phase must be attended to and treated seriously; meetings determine whether or not the organization can get things done, resolve issues, and foster a feeling of community. How Do You Hold an Effective Meeting?

Running a meeting involves more than simply guiding the group through the plan. When you preside over a meeting, you are accountable for the group’s sound and its members. This entails paying great attention to group dynamics, other factors, and process concerns.

Meeting facilitation is a skill, not something you are born with. As with any skill, keep practising it also makes you more confident.

An excellent meeting occurs when the phases of meeting management are addressed:

  • Preparation For the Event
  • Organizing The Meeting
  • Meeting Management
  • Evaluation

Stages of Meetings

Meetings can be quite beneficial in terms of planning and decision-making. They don’t have to be unpleasant. They can even be enjoyable. You could also learn how to create valuable and fun meetings for everyone in attendance.

Here are several stages of meetings that effectively help your group achieve its objectives:

Make An Agenda– with essential meeting participants. Consider the overall goal of the meeting and the actions that must take place to achieve that goal. The plan should be set up to complete these activities during the session.

Creating Meeting Ground Rules– indeed, you don’t need to develop new ground rules for every meeting.

However, it is beneficial to have a few basic ground rules that may be followed for most of your sessions. These ground rules foster the essential components required for a successful meeting.

Four powerful ground rules are:

  • Participate,
  • Focus,
  • Keep momentum,
  • And reach closure.

Time Management– is one of the most challenging facilitation duties since time tends to run out before activities are accomplished. As a result, the most challenging aspect is maintaining momentum to keep the process moving.

You could ask attendees to assist you in keeping track of the time.

The scheduled time of the plan is getting out of hand, bringing it to the group, and soliciting feedback on a solution.

Evaluate– It’s astonishing how often people complain about a meeting being a terrible waste of time – but only after the meeting.

Gather their input during the meeting so that you may immediately enhance the meeting process. Evaluating a meeting solely at the conclusion is frequently too late to act on participant comments.

Closing– Always end the meeting on time and try to end in a positive tone. At the end of a session, review activities and tasks, schedule the time for the next meeting and ask each participant if they can make it or not.

Always confirm that the meeting minutes and actions will be communicated back to members within a week.
